Transaction a63c84def8e5e99be661977fa76e4fe20fa6ed593ebb5dc863d9ca006a2ee2de

1 Input
2 Outputs
  • a63c84def8e5e99be661977fa76e4fe20fa6ed593ebb5dc863d9ca006a2ee2de:0
  • value  295095
    address  3DadDZ4DwvyPLhovjtebbYrwPE8HvHpYLc
  • a63c84def8e5e99be661977fa76e4fe20fa6ed593ebb5dc863d9ca006a2ee2de:1
  • value  118164276
    address  3FzfXWbL6M8ZRFjPY6byLzrVVSG49uT8FU